The Complete Guide to Door Repairing: Fixes, Costs, and When to Call a Pro

Doors are the unrecognized heroes of any office or home. They provide security, personal privacy, insulation, and aesthetic appeal. Yet, people rarely think of them up until something goes incorrect-- a persistent lock, a squeaky hinge, a drafty space, or worse, a door that declines to close entirely.

Door fixing is a common home maintenance job that can drastically enhance the comfort, security, and energy efficiency of a residential or commercial property. Whether you are handling minor annoyances or significant structural damage, comprehending the principles of door repair can save time, money, and aggravation.


Typical Door Problems and Their Causes

Before diving into repair work, it assists to comprehend what normally goes wrong with doors. In time, consistent use, moving structures, humidity changes, and wear-and-tear take a toll on both interior and exterior doors.

Here are the most frequent concerns house owners encounter:

  • Squeaking or Binding Hinges: Usually triggered by a lack of lubrication or loose screws.
  • Sticking Doors: Often the outcome of seasonal humidity changes causing wood to swell, or a home settling, which misaligns the frame and the door.
  • Drafts and Light Leaks: Caused by worn-out weatherstripping or a distorted door.
  • Harmed Locks and Latches: Can result from misalignment between the latch and the strike plate, or internal mechanical failure of the lockset.
  • Holes and Cracks: Common in hollow-core interior doors due to unexpected effects.

DIY Door Repair vs. Professional Services

While numerous door repair work are straightforward weekend DIY tasks, others require specific tools and expertise. Making the right choice between a DIY fix and hiring a professional depends upon the seriousness of the problem and the type of door involved.

When to DIY:

  • Tightening loose hinge screws.
  • Lubing squeaky hinges or tracks.
  • Changing basic doorknobs and locks.
  • Using new weatherstripping.
  • Planing a slight edge to stop a door from sticking.

When to Call a Professional:

  • Repairing extreme rot or water damage on exterior doors.
  • Changing heavy steel or solid wood security doors.
  • Repairing complex moving glass door systems.
  • Realigning heavily sagging door frames that require structural change.
  • Setting up clever locks that need precise electrical or mechanical integration.

Door Repair Cost Breakdown

Understanding the financial investment needed for door repair work helps in budgeting. Expenses can vary considerably based on the products, labor rates in the city, and whether the job requires a simple fix or a total replacement.

Door Repair TypeTypical DIY Cost (Materials)Average Professional Cost (Parts + Labor)
Hinge Repair/ Replacement₤ 5-- ₤ 15₤ 75-- ₤ 150
Repairing a Stuck Door (Planing)₤ 0-- ₤ 10 (tools needed)₤ 100-- ₤ 250
Lockset/ Deadbolt Replacement₤ 25-- ₤ 100₤ 150-- ₤ 300
Weatherstripping Installation₤ 15-- ₤ 40₤ 100-- ₤ 200
Hole/ Dent Repair (Interior)₤ 10-- ₤ 30₤ 120-- ₤ 250
Sliding glass repairs Door Roller Fix₤ 20-- ₤ 50₤ 200-- ₤ 400

Disclaimer: Prices are quotes and differ based on geographical place and the specific intricacy of the repair.


Step-by-Step Guides for Common DIY Door Repairs

If you prefer to take on minor door concerns yourself, here are instructions for two of the most typical home door issues.

1. Repairing a Squeaky or Loose Hinge

A squeaky door is a simple repair, however a loose hinge requires a bit more attention.

  1. Find the issue: Open and close the door slowly to pinpoint the problematic hinge.
  2. Tighten screws: Use a screwdriver to tighten up any loose screws. If the screw holes have become removed, eliminate the screws, insert a small wood sliver (or a toothpick covered in wood glue) into the hole, and reinsert the screw for a tight grip.
  3. Lubricate: If the door squeaks, use a few drops of light-weight machine oil, silicone spray, or petroleum jelly to the hinge pin. Clean away any excess.

2. Adjusting a Sticking Door

If a door rubs versus the frame when closing, it is usually because the leading hinge is loose, triggering the door to sag, or the wood has broadened.

  1. Check the hinges: Tighten all screws on the leading and middle hinges.
  2. Utilize the longer screw trick: If tightening up does not work, replace one brief screw on the frame side of the leading hinge with a 3-inch wood screw. Drive it deep into the framing stud to pull the entire door assembly back into alignment.
  3. Airplane the edge: If the door still sticks after changing the hinges, utilize a block aircraft or a sander to shave down a small fraction of wood from the sticking edge, then repaint or seal the exposed wood.

Preventive Maintenance Tips

To extend the lifespan of your doors and Double Glazed Window Repairs Near Me lessen the need for unforeseen repair work, follow these basic preventive maintenance steps twice a year:

  • Check Weatherstripping: Inspect exterior doors every year for cracks, tears, or compression. Change worn strips to preserve home energy performance.
  • Keep Tracks Clean: For moving glass doors and pocket doors, vacuum out dust, hair, and Lock Repair debris from the tracks frequently. Lube tracks with a silicone-based spray (prevent sticky lubes like grease, which draw in dirt).
  • Check Hardware: Periodically examine doorknobs, handles, strikes plates, and deadbolts to ensure they are safe and secure and functioning efficiently.
  • Control Indoor Humidity: Since wood expands and contracts with moisture, maintaining a stable indoor humidity level using a/c or dehumidifiers assists prevent wood doors from deforming and sticking.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)

1. How do I know if my door needs to be fixed or entirely replaced?

If the damage is simply cosmetic (minor scratches, loose hardware, little holes), a repair suffices. Nevertheless, if the door is greatly distorted, rotten from wetness damage, broken entirely through, or no longer provides appropriate home security, total replacement is normally the better long-lasting investment.

2. Can hollow-core interior doors be fixed if they get a hole in them?

Yes. Due to the fact that hollow-core doors are primarily empty space inside, you can repair a hole by packing crumpled paper or expanding foam inside to serve as a support, applying a mesh patch, covering it with drywall compound or wood filler, sanding it smooth, and painting over the patched location.

3. Why does my outside door let in a draft?

Drafts usually occur due to compressed, damaged, or missing out on weatherstripping around the door frame, or a gap beneath the door. Installing a new door sweep at the bottom and replacing perimeter weatherstripping typically solves the problem.

4. Is it possible to fix a door that won't latch properly?

The majority of the time, a door that will not lock is just experiencing misalignment between the latch bolt and the strike plate. You can typically fix this by loosening up the screws on the strike plate and shifting it somewhat up or down, or by filing down the inside lip of the strike plate opening.
